Topics include trust model, revenue conversations, executive presence, and managing difficult conversations. From $2,200/day + travel. ## Methodology The dojo method is built on three pillars: 1. Real challenges — participants bring actual upcoming challenges (hard conversations, pitches, negotiations) and work them live. 2. Roleplay under pressure — repeated practice until the right response becomes automatic. 3. Frameworks that explain why — classical rhetoric (Aristotle, Cicero, the five canons) combined with behavioral brain science. ## Contact - Website: https://nextupleader.com - Email: isaiah@nextupleader.com - LinkedIn: https://www.linkedin.com/company/nextupleader - Location: Austin, Texas
